What is the scope of MBBS degree in USA 2024


 The scope of an MBBS degree in the USA in 2024 can be nuanced, depending on whether you completed your MBBS in the USA or abroad. Here's a breakdown for both scenarios:

MBBS from a US-accredited Medical School:

  • Direct Practice: With your MBBS degree and a successful passing of the United States Medical Licensing Examination (USMLE), you're eligible to apply for residency programs in the USA. Completing a residency is mandatory for independent medical practice in any specialty.
  • Residency Options: USMLE opens doors to numerous residency specializations across diverse fields like Internal Medicine, Surgery, Dermatology, Psychiatry, Ophthalmology, etc.
  • Job Market: The demand for doctors in the USA is generally high, but competition within specific specialties can vary. Thorough research on job prospects within your chosen field is crucial.
  • Salary Potential: Salaries for physicians in the USA can be very competitive, with higher-demand specialties often exceeding $300,000 annually after several years of experience.

MBBS from a Non-US Accredited Medical School:

  • USMLE Eligibility: Your MBBS degree might not automatically qualify you for the USMLE. You might need to take additional qualifying exams, depending on the accreditation status of your medical school.
  • Pathway to Practice: Similar to US-accredited graduates, you'll need to pass the USMLE and complete a residency program to practice medicine independently in the USA.
  • Residency Options: While residency options are available, securing a competitive residency can be more challenging for international graduates compared to US graduates.
  • Career Alternatives: Research and public health roles are alternative pathways for utilizing your medical knowledge without practicing directly.

Additional Points:

  • Visa Considerations: Obtaining a work visa for medical practice in the USA can be complex, and securing sponsorship from healthcare institutions might be required.
  • Financial Implications: Residencies in the USA typically involve lower salaries compared to practicing doctors, but they offer valuable training and experience.
  • Networking and Mentorship: Building connections with established medical professionals in the USA can be immensely valuable for international graduates navigating the system.


Overall, an MBBS degree can offer promising career prospects in the USA, but the path to independent practice requires additional steps and thorough planning, especially for graduates from non-US accredited schools.
